When building with ARCH=i386, readq and writeq are not defined,
resulting in:

intel_uncore.h: In function ‘__raw_uncore_read64’:
intel_uncore.h:257:9: error: implicit declaration of function ‘readq’;
        did you mean ‘readl’? [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
  return read##s__(uncore->regs + i915_mmio_reg_offset(reg)); \
         ^

and:

intel_uncore.h: In function ‘__raw_uncore_write64’:
intel_uncore.h:264:2: error: implicit declaration of function ‘writeq’;
        did you mean ‘writel’? [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
  write##s__(val, uncore->regs + i915_mmio_reg_offset(reg)); \
  ^

Add the io-64-nonatomic-lo-hi include to have readq and writeq available
for all builds. This header internally includes linux/io.h, so the
native readq and writeq definitions will be used when available.
